I am making two mission style rail & stile doors (21" x 75")
I had planned on using 1/4" oak plywood for the panels (2 in each door)

1/4" (3/16" actual) oak plywood seems kind of flimsy.
Would I be better off using 3/8" (5/16" actual)



Raised panel doors were originally designed to address this problem.

The 3/4" or 5/8" panel was raised and the raised part was on the
hidden side.

I would use the easily available 1/2" ply and cut a rabbet to form a
tongue that would fit the groove.
Let the balance of the ply show towards the back, as they intended
with the raised panel.
